Flyers That Sell: 7 Proven Tricks to Make Yours Convert (and Get Read)

Want to know how to design a flyer that actually works? Effective flyers do more than look good—they grab attention, communicate one clear message, and give people a reason to act. In this guide, you’ll learn seven practical flyer design tips to create flyers that get read, generate interest, and turn attention into real results.

 

1. Grab Attention in 3 Seconds or Less

Headline = hook. It’s the first thing your audience sees. If it’s generic, they’re gone.

Instead of: “Now Open!”

Try: “Free Coffee for First-Time Guests — This Weekend Only”

Use emotional keywords, numbers, and urgency (e.g., “limited,” “now,” “today only”). These drive higher flyer conversion rates.

 

2. One Goal, One CTA

Don’t confuse them. Flyers that convert stick to one action.

  • Want calls? Show your phone number. 
  • Want bookings? Highlight your URL or QR code. 
  • Want signups? Make the offer BIG and visible. 

Pro tip: Put the CTA in at least two places (top + bottom). Repetition = action.

 

3. Use the PAS Formula (Problem, Agitation, Solution)

Top copywriters use this structure to stop the scroll — and it works in print too.

Example for a wellness coach flyer:

Feeling exhausted all the time?
Most women ignore burnout until it becomes a crisis.
Book your free 1:1 energy consult today.

It speaks directly to your audience’s pain point — and offers a clear next step.

 

4. Make It Feel Like a Gift, Not an Ad

People keep flyers when they offer something useful — not just a pitch.

Try this:

  • Add a 10% off code 
  • Include a short checklist 
  • Share a quote, recipe, or local guide 
  • Highlight a timeline or event calendar 

Bonus: Make it Instagrammable. Beautiful flyers don’t just convert — they get shared.

 

5. Look Pro — Not DIY

A flimsy, low-res flyer says “I’m not legit.”

 A bold, well-printed piece says “I mean business.”

  • Use high-quality stock (matte for luxury, gloss for promos) 
  • Add rounded corners or extra-thick paper for longevity 
  • Keep colors consistent with your brand kit 

 

6. Trackable = Scalable

Even print can be performance-driven.

  • Add a unique QR code
  • Use a custom URL or landing page
  • Include a campaign-specific promo code

That way, you’ll know exactly what worked — and where to double down.

 

7. Think Beyond the Event

Most people think flyers are just for grand openings or weekend sales.

But top-performing businesses use flyers year-round to:

  • Onboard new clients 
  • Include in product shipments 
  • Promote pop-up events 
  • Leave behind after service calls or consultations 

They’re low cost, high visibility, and highly repeatable — especially when printed in bulk.

 

Common Flyer Mistakes That Kill Conversions

  • Too much text → no one reads it
  • Weak or generic headline
  • No clear CTA
  • Trying to promote too many things at once

Fix: Keep it simple, focused, and action-driven.

FAQ SECTION

How do you design flyers that work?
Focus on one clear goal, a strong headline, and a visible CTA. Keep the message simple and benefit-driven.

What makes a flyer effective?
An effective flyer grabs attention fast, speaks to a specific audience, and gives a clear reason to act.

Do flyers still work for marketing?
Yes. Flyers are highly effective for local marketing, events, and promotions—especially when paired with a strong offer.

How can I make my flyer stand out?
Use bold headlines, high-quality printing, and a clear offer. Adding a QR code can also boost engagement.
